There is a golden period each child or young adult has: between the age of 16 and 25 (kids can start as early as six), when your child is still living at home. During this period, he or she has a wonderful opportunity to create a real income greater than their monthly expense needs! This allows him or her to achieve the power of income safety while their expense needs are still low and their parents are present to support and provide perspective.

The opportunity:
Pick a useful topic that helps other kids learn and make a short video to teach it. You'll earn money when people watch your video, and it will keep paying you every time someone watches it.

Passive Income is - Getting money every month by doing some work at the start, and then not having to do much after that to keep getting paid.
Income safety is - Having a few different people (customers or employers) who pay you for your work, so if one of them stops working with you (or you get fired), you still have money coming in from the other people.
Leverage - Leverage is using a smart tool or idea to make your work easier and get bigger results with less effort.
